The basics:

Born 28 Dec 1887 and birth registered in Paddington Mar qtr 1888.

Baptised 18 Mar 1888 at St John Paddington.  Parents: Alleyne Boxall, Esq., and Mary Elizabeth.

Educated at Eton College and later the Royal Military College (Sandhurst) - passed out in 1907.

Joined the Hampshire Regt in Oct 1907.  Served overseas in South Africa, Mauritius and India pre-WW1.

Died on active service 27 Apr 1915 (Dardanelles). At the time of his death he was a Captain in HM 2nd Battalion, Hampshire Regt.

Commemorated, Helles Memorial:

He arrived Algoa Bay, Cape Town 3 September 1910 he travelled first class, ship called SAXON from Southampton.

His will was probated by his father Alleyne Alfred Boxall on 21 June 1915 in London.

His parents married 22 October 1881 at Holy Trinity Church, Finchley
Alleyne Alfred Boxall, esquire, address 14 Cambridge Square, Hyde Park, father William Percival Boxall, esquire
Mary Elizabeth Lermitte of Knighton, Finchley, father James Henry Lermitte, esquire
Witnesses W Percival Boxall, James Henry Lermitte, Harriet Lermitte, Henry J Lermitte and David Smith Mayor of Brighton.

Caryl Lermitte Boxall, had 2 brothers and 2 sisters
Alleyne Percival Boxall 1883-1945, a solicitor like his father
Algernon G E Boxall 1886-1901age 15.
Mildred Mary Lucy Boxall 1884-11 March 1931 never married
Dorothy Quinta Boxall 9 March 1890-1970 age 80 never married
